$40K in Tokyo = $90,760 in San Francisco
Your $40K salary in Tokyo (COL 86) has the same purchasing power as $90,760 in San Francisco (COL 194). San Francisco is more expensive โ you'd need 127% more to maintain the same lifestyle.
Budget breakdown โ $40K in both cities
What $40K actually buys you in each city after taxes and core expenses.
| Expense | Tokyo $40K | San Francisco $40K (same salary) |
|---|---|---|
| Monthly take-home | $2,062 | $2,418 |
| 1BR rent | $1,200 | $3,600 |
| Groceries | $380 | $448 |
| Transport | $150 | $100 |
| Utilities | $90 | $160 |
| Internet | $30 | $70 |
| Left after essentials | $212/month | -$1,960/month |

How is the salary equivalent calculated?
The equivalent salary is calculated by multiplying your current salary by the ratio of the two cities' overall cost of living indices: $40K ร (194 รท 86) = $90,760. This adjusts for differences in housing, food, transport, and general cost of living.
